IVTScrip™ mRNA-Anti-S, REGN-10933(Cap 0, 5-Methoxy-UTP, 120 nt-poly(A))   (CAT#: GTTS-WQ13799MR)

This product GTTS-WQ13799MR is a type of mRNA having 120 nt poly(A) tail and modified with Cap 0 & 5-Methoxy-UTP. It ecodes the monoclonal antibody that targets S gene. The antibody can be applied in Sever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2) infection (COVID-19) research.
